In the afternoon we reached Covasna, the old spa and health resort… All the hotels were full, because that, at the end of the week, the town sheltered a Traditional Song and Dance Festival in the Fairy Valley… We were pretty concerned because it was getting late and harder to find somewhere to spend the night.
So, we were near the road scanning our map and wondering what to do next… when a man asked us what happened… He also told us he had retired and he had moved in Covasna one month before and he was happy to help some fellows from his native Bucharest… He called someone and set everything for us to go to his friend’s villa in Comandau, a little forest locality. He assured us that we would be very satisfied and we could stay as much as we like…

And he was right… The forest road wound for 20 km till 1000m height… The view was great… The smell was relaxing… The villa was a nice wood construction and we had it all at our disposal for 70RON/night (22$/night)…

It also had a brick grill and in the back, a winter sport track… Wow! Too bad we were in the summertime and we couldn’t ski…

We were absolutely amazed by that place… Because we were used to go, like many people from Bucharest, to the Prahova Valley (Brasov, Sinaia, Poiana Brasaov, Predeal etc), the nearest and most famous tourist zone from our country…
We discussed with the man that let us in and he told us that many families from Bucharest bought house lots in the area and that the zone was growing…
We spent just a night there, we had a nice dinner with grilled meat, potatos and some finger-shaped “mici” …Yam, yam! :)
